The Effects of Synthetic Cathinone 3-MMC on the Brain
Synthetic cathinones, like 3-MMC, cause significant alterations on brain chemistry. These compounds mimic the effects of naturally occurring amphetamines, activating the release of click here d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and reward. This surge in dopamine produces feelings of euphoria and energy, but prolonged exposure to 3-MMC can lead to tolerance. The constant overstimulation impairs the brain's natural reward pathways, making it difficult for individuals to experience pleasure from everyday activities.
Furthermore, 3-MMC can impact other neurotransmitters like serotonin and norepinephrine, leading to a range of negative outcomes. These can include anxiety, paranoia, insomnia, and even hallucinations. The sustained effects of 3-MMC on the brain are not fully understood, but emerging evidence suggests a risk for lasting cognitive problems.
